+Cities of the Dead+: Swinbrook, Oxfordshire
http://cemgroupie.blogspot.com/2010/08/cotswolds.html
Set in the picturesque Cotswolds, this was the very first English cemetery I paid a visit to. One of the more prominent graves to be found in Swinbrook is that of Unity Mitford.
